A bit about you: you’re an amazing designer, a natural communicator with a fantastic portfolio in graphic design. As a people person, you enjoy helping others and working in a team while supporting the wider Engagement Team with design and online communication.
No two days will be the same. In this role you’ll play an important role in assisting with the production of Council’s printed and online collateral including posters, signs, brochures, guides and other public documents. You’ll also assist the team with the content and maintenance of all Council’s websites, intranet and social media platforms.

Gisborne District Council is the local government, both district and regional authority for Tairawhiti, New Zealand. We are the proud winners of the 2019 LGNZ Excellence Awards, for our work to grow and promote the well-being of our community and people.
